Duties & Responsibilities
RESPONSIBILITIES:
- Manage crews deployed to your assigned worksites;
- Act as first point of contact for customer and public escalations and issues;
- Collect and review timesheets for all line construction employees and monitor daily progress;
- Organize work schedules, lodging, travel, vacations, vehicle repairs and per diems as needed;
- Complete jobsite inspections, and ensures that all company safety policies and procedures are being followed and that all required paperwork is completed and submitted on time;
- Monitor projects for changes to the scope the work. Clearly identify all changes to the scope of work on timesheets and communicate with key stakeholders to acquire written pre-approval where necessary. Follow all internal and customer directed change request processes which may involve redlining work plans, collection of supporting documentation and the submission of online forms. Change-requests may be required due to safety conditions, work plan errors, delays due to customer “not ready” conditions, etc.;
- Respond to safety incidents and/or inquiries from workers in a timely manner;
- Investigation of incidents, both safety and non-safety related in conjunction with Safety team;
- Manage fleet and material stocking at your assigned projects/worksites;
- Manage your assigned worksite project scoping;
- Responsible for ensuring that projects are completed on time and on budget, escalating any concerns or issues that may affect these deadlines;
- Cable management in the yard;
- Civil access quoting;
- Ensure Technician development and conduct performance review
- After-hours call outs for your projects;
- Travel as required.
